The aspirants seeking admission for a Doctorate of Philosophy (Ph.D) / Integrated Ph,D programmes or theoretical Computer Science in one of the participating institutions, may appear for the Joint Entrance Screening Test (JEST 2014).
JEST 2014 is the qualifying test for admissions to Ph.D programmes in the central government funded institutions across India.
Qualifying in JEST does not entitle an applicant to get a Research Fellowship. Using the JEST results, each institute will call a limited number of candidates for further selection depending on their requirtements.
All the selected candidates will receive Research Fellowship form the respective institutes.
Eligibility:
Physics:
Candidates should have M.Sc. in Physics or M.Sc. / M.E. / M.Tech. in related disciplines.
Theoretical Computer Science:
Candidates should have M.Sc./ M.E. / M.Tech. / M.C.A. in Computer Science and related disciplines, and should be interested in the mathematical aspects of computer science.
Integrated M.Sc / M.Tech - Ph.D programme:
Candidates must have passed B.Sc / B.E / B.Tech degree in relevant discipline form any recognised university.
